WETUMPKA – A female inmate was found dead Wednesday morning in the Elmore County Jail, said Sheriff Bill Franklin.

Dianna Marie Layne, 39, of Pell City was found unresponsive in her cell at about 6:20 a.m., he said. She was in a cell by herself.

"Our staff had contact with her about 6:07 a.m.," Franklin said. "They asked her if she was going to eat her breakfast. About 15 minutes later, they checked on her again and she was unresponsive.

"Jail staff called for medical assistance, but Ms. Layne had in fact expired."

Her body has been sent to the Alabama Department of Forensic Science for an autopsy, he said.

Layne was brought to the jail Friday evening by Poarch Creek Tribal Police, Franklin said. She had been arrested at the Wind Creek Casino in Wetumpka on a charge of possession of a controlled substance, he said. She was allegedly in possession of 22 morphine pills, he said.
